I could see Fairweather and Deal on the field together in obvious run downs.

I also could see Fairweather and Fromm in bunch sets standing up on each end of the line in passing situations. The could chip the ends then release into their routes.

I think the ability of Fromm and Fairweather to also collect defenders up the seams will open under routes for our slot guys.

And yes Deal and his blocking and ability to catch the easy pass will help. Maybe lined up offset from the QB and RB. Crosses across the face of the QB like he is going to block only to slip out into the flat with a big boy wide open ready to punish a backside safety when he tries to tackle. Obviously this could be any of our “blocking” TEs I just think Deal is out best of those and still has quality hands.
